PURPOSE: An apparatus for manufacturing anatase titanium dioxide nanopowder is provided to prevent accidents induced by abrupt reaction during manufacturing, to simplify the manufacturing process, and to reduce the manufacturing time, thereby mass-producing anatase titanium dioxide in a uniform sub-10 nm size.;CONSTITUTION: An apparaturs for manufacturing anatase titanium dioxide nanopowder (4000) comprises a first vessel (4100) and a second vessel (4200). The first vessel includes a first inflow pipe (4110) and an outflow pipe (4120), and contains TiCl4 solution. The second vessel contains water and is separated by an ion exchange membrane (4230) into a first region (4210) and a second region (4220). The first region includes a second inflow pipe (4240) and a titanium electrode (4213). The second region includes a platinum electrode (4223). The interiors of both the first and the second vessels are in a nitrogen atmosphere. The bottom of the second vessel is contained in a cooling part (4250). A churner (4211) is installed on the first region of the second vessel. As nitrogen flows in, TiCl4 solution contained in the first vessel moves to the first region of the second vessel.;COPYRIGHT KIPO 2013
